Part of a color set with a panoramic view of Silverton and Kendall Mountain in the background (see 2006:002.54). The back (undivided back) has a one (1) cent stamp, postmark (no year), address only, a logo (back upper left) with the words Excelsior, Leipzig Berlin Dresden, and a clove shape with the letters A, N, C, N, Y. Postcard has rounded corners. "Made in Germany" is written on the address side of the card.

Photograph of the narrow gauge railroad crossing the Animas River near Silverton, high in the rugged San Juan Mountains of Southwest Colorado. The 90-mile round trip from Durango is made daily in the tourist season.

Only a coat of paint has been added to change the atmosphere of this old bar (the Bent Elbow) famous in the early 1880's as one of Blair Street's liveliest spots. Remnants of its glorious past serve to make this a favorite attraction to Summer visitors.
